Objective To establish a hypoxia amimal model with different exposed periods and severe intermittent hypoxia and to explore effects of severe intermittent hypoxia on learning and memory function in rats.Methods Male Wistar rats(n=48) were randomly divided into chronic intermittent hypoxia group and control group.The 5% hypoxia models was made with hypoxia box.AT 2,4,6,and 8 weeks after hypoxia,the morphologic changes of neuron were observed with HE staining.The learning and memory ability of the rats were assessed with Morris water maze.Results Compared with the control group,neuronal morphologic structure in the hypoxia group was damaged significantly.The survival neuronal density was decreased with prolonged hypoxia(13.18 ± 2.18).The mean of escaping latency period was 49.17±8.87,58.47±6.98,65.15±7.44,and 68.42±7.91 seconds at 2,4,6,and 8 weeks in intermittent hypoxia group,which was decreased with prolonged hypoxia(P0.5).Conclusion Intermittent hypoxia can cause nerve cell damage and learning-memory dysfunction.The damage increases with the prolonged intermittent hypoxia.
